Swimming superstar Ellie Simmonds has stormed to a second gold swimming medal, and has a third in her sights.
Simmonds has swept the board after winning the 400m freestyle on Saturday and 200m individual medley on Monday, after welcoming the audience into "her house".
The Prime Minister and former PM Gordon Brown witnessed the second gold in world record time, and it was David Cameron who presented the 17-year-old with her medal.
On Tuesday, she will compete in the 50m freestyle along with fellow Briton Natalie Jones, who won bronze on Monday.
ParalympicsGB start the day with an impressive 63 medals, including 19 gold, 25 silver and 19 bronze - ahead of schedule for the 103 medal target.
